Where does Charlie Bucket live?

Charlie Bucket is a character in the books "Charlie and the Chocolate Factory" and "Charlie and the Great Glass Elevator" by Roald Dahl. He lives in a drafty house at the edge of a great town in England, according to shmoop.com
In the beginning of the first book, "Charlie and the Chocolate Factory", Charlie Bucket and his family live on the edge of a town not specifically named by the author. It is assumed by Shmoop and many readers that the town is in England, as the author, Roald Dahl was British. By the end of the books, they use the Glass Elevator to bring his family back to the factory to live.
